Abstract
Herein, we report a RuH2(CO)(PPh3)3 catalyzed direct amidation of alcohols using readily available nitro compounds via a catalytic borrowing hydrogen method. This reaction proceeded via cascade reactions, including oxidation of alcohol, reduction of nitro group and formation of amides under one-pot condition. This protocol provides a single catalytic system for many reactions, a step economic advantage over the available techniques, tolerates various functionalities, and was demonstrated with broad substrate scope (47 examples).
